[Note Guidelines] Photographer's Note
Yesterday evening I went out to get my summer car from its wintercamp, I put it there to protect it from salt and dirt and of course me driving it during winter. The place was a very old farm lying above 1000m sealevel in the mountains of northern Carinthia. I put it there because I hadn't to pay for its stay...

When I arrived the battery was emty, but it ran after 3 meters pulling it. It ran immideatly after a rest of more than five months.

I did a few shots of the parked car (with flash so nothing for here...) - and after that my cam (the Sony) crashed. E 61:00:00, strange noises out of the camera. Sh***.

When driving home I tried to make a few shots and saw, that the engine for the focus must be blocked (see the freehand-do-not-look-shot I'm just posting...). When I came home, I hit it several times and now it runs again *G*...
